Herpes simplex virus 1 host cell entry receptors (HSV-1 entry receptors)

Overview

Host cell entry receptors for HSV-1 are a diverse group of cell surface molecules that facilitate the multi-step process of viral attachment and penetration into various human tissues. The entry process typically begins with the virus binding to heparan sulfate proteoglycans (HSPG) for initial attachment, followed by the specific interaction of viral glycoprotein D (gD) with one of three primary receptors: Nectin-1 (a cell adhesion molecule), Herpesvirus Entry Mediator (HVEM, a TNF receptor superfamily member), or 3-O-sulfated heparan sulfate. Additionally, other host factors such as PILR-alpha, NMHC-IIA, and MAG interact with viral glycoprotein B (gB) to trigger the fusion of the viral envelope with the host cell membrane. These receptors determine the tissue tropism of the virus, with Nectin-1 being the primary receptor in epithelial and neuronal cells, while HVEM is prominent in lymphoid cells. Because these receptors are essential for the establishment of both lytic and latent infections, they are significant targets for antiviral drug development. Therapeutic strategies include the use of entry inhibitors like docosanol, which disrupts membrane fusion, and experimental agents such as peptides or small molecules that block specific glycoprotein-receptor interactions. However, targeting these host proteins poses challenges due to their endogenous roles in immune signaling and cell-cell adhesion.
